In Aotearoa New Zealand, low-risk drinking advice is currently under review, although concerns have been raised about alcohol industry influence in this process, and the challenges of revising alcohol policy. Any review of low-risk drinking advice must be assessed not only against current scientific evidence, but also against Te Tiriti o Waitangi obligations to protect Māori health, reduce inequities and enable Māori participation and decision making in alcohol policy.
